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Used in RPC |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All
Print Page as PDF
Routine: BQIUTB

Package: iCare

Routine: BQIUTB


Information

BQIUTB ;PRXM/HC/ALA-Table utilities ; 02 Nov 2005 2:52 PM

Source Information

Source file <BQIUTB.m>

Call Graph

Call Graph Total: 17

Package Total Call Graph
iCare 9 EN^BQIMSLST  COMM^BQINIGH1  UPD^BQITAXX4  IUSR^BQIUTB1  (APST,CLIN,DPCP,EPLIST,FLTR,IPCAT,MUT,PRST,UCL,VFL)^BQIUTB2  (ALG,COD,CPT,DET,DIV,DXN,EMP,LAB,LABR,LANG,MED,POVS,PROB,PROBS)^BQIUTB3  (ACM,CRM,EDACU,EDTYP,EDUC,EPICK,ETOP,EVTYP,FSPEC,IATYP,IDTYP,PRFC,TMFRAM,WARD)^BQIUTB4  (FH80,FHREL,LOC,PRCL,USR)^BQIUTB5  
MEAS^BQIUTB6  
VA Fileman 4 DT^DICRW  $$GET1^DID  ($$ROOT,$$VFILE)^DILFD  $$GET1^DIQ  
Kernel 2 ^%ZTER  $$NOW^XLFDT  
Authorization Subscription 1 $$CURRENT^USRLM  
Registration 1 $$LOWER^VALM1  

Caller Graph

Caller Graph Total: 6

Package Total Caller Graph
iCare 3 BQI202PU  BQIPLLAY  BQIVFTLK  
Patient Care Component Reports 2 APCLACG  APCLACGI  
Tracking Procedure Workflow 1 BTPWTAB  

Entry Points

Name Comments DBIA/ICR reference
COMMTX(DATA) ;EP - Get list of Community Taxonomies
VW(DATA) ;EP - Get the table of customized views
ERR ;
CMT(DATA) ;EP - Get the table of comments that users can select from
TBS(DATA) ;EP - Get a list of GUI tabs
SEX(DATA) ;EP - Get a list of sexes
TBL(DATA,FILE,INAC) ;EP - Generic table retrieve function
TSTA(DATA) ;EP - Get the table of tag statuses
BEN(DATA) ;EP - Get list of Beneficiary Codes
CLS(PR) ; Get user classification
REG(DATA) ;EP - Get the table of registers
DCT(DATA) ;EP - Get the table of diagnoses categories
REM(DATA) ;EP - Reminders
DONE
TAB(DATA,TEXT) ; PEP -- BQI GET TABLE
COMM(DATA,FILE,FLAG) ;EP - Get the Community Table

External References

Name Field # of Occurrence
^%ZTER ERR+1
EN^BQIMSLST VW+2
COMM^BQINIGH1 COMM+5
UPD^BQITAXX4 COMMTX+12
IUSR^BQIUTB1 TAB+45, TAB+47
APST^BQIUTB2 TAB+81
CLIN^BQIUTB2 TAB+36
DPCP^BQIUTB2 TAB+31
EPLIST^BQIUTB2 TAB+103
FLTR^BQIUTB2 TAB+105
IPCAT^BQIUTB2 TAB+59
MUT^BQIUTB2 TAB+19
PRST^BQIUTB2 TAB+82
UCL^BQIUTB2 TAB+109
VFL^BQIUTB2 TAB+77, TAB+79
ALG^BQIUTB3 TAB+107
COD^BQIUTB3 TAB+132
CPT^BQIUTB3 TAB+88
DET^BQIUTB3 TAB+17
DIV^BQIUTB3 TAB+117
DXN^BQIUTB3 TAB+62
EMP^BQIUTB3 TAB+115
LAB^BQIUTB3 TAB+84
LABR^BQIUTB3 TAB+85
LANG^BQIUTB3 TAB+67
MED^BQIUTB3 TAB+87
POVS^BQIUTB3 TAB+63
PROB^BQIUTB3 TAB+90
PROBS^BQIUTB3 TAB+91
ACM^BQIUTB4 TAB+119
CRM^BQIUTB4 TAB+99
EDACU^BQIUTB4 TAB+130
EDTYP^BQIUTB4 TAB+128
EDUC^BQIUTB4 TAB+26
EPICK^BQIUTB4 TAB+27
ETOP^BQIUTB4 TAB+25
EVTYP^BQIUTB4 TAB+129
FSPEC^BQIUTB4 TAB+124
IATYP^BQIUTB4 TAB+125
IDTYP^BQIUTB4 TAB+126
PRFC^BQIUTB4 TAB+68
TMFRAM^BQIUTB4 TAB+21, TAB+22, TAB+23
WARD^BQIUTB4 TAB+123
FH80^BQIUTB5 TAB+111
FHREL^BQIUTB5 TAB+113
LOC^BQIUTB5 TAB+40, TAB+41
PRCL^BQIUTB5 TAB+30
USR^BQIUTB5 TAB+29, TAB+43
MEAS^BQIUTB6 TAB+121
DT^DICRW TAB+12
$$GET1^DID TBL+19
$$ROOT^DILFD TBL+18
$$VFILE^DILFD TBL+16
$$GET1^DIQ TBL+28, CMT+8, TBS+9, DCT+6, DCT+8, DCT+9, DCT+11, DCT+13, REG+7, REG+8
, REG+9, REG+10, REG+11, COMMTX+10
$$CURRENT^USRLM CLS+3
$$LOWER^VALM1 TBL+30
$$NOW^XLFDT ERR+3

Used in RPC

RPC Name Call Tags
BQI GET TABLE TAB

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^ATXAX - [#9002226] GET1^DIQ
^BQI(90506.2 - [#90506.2] GET1^DIQ
^BQI(90506.4 - [#90506.4] GET1^DIQ
^BQI(90507 - [#90507] GET1^DIQ
^BQI(90509.1 - [#90509.1] GET1^DIQ

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^ATXAX - [#9002226] COMMTX+4, COMMTX+5, COMMTX+7, COMMTX+8
^AUTTBEN - [#9999999.25] BEN+4, BEN+5, BEN+6
^AUTTCOM("B" COMMTX+9
^BQI(90506.1 - [#90506.1] REM+4, REM+5, REM+6
^BQI(90506.2 - [#90506.2] DCT+5
^BQI(90506.3 - [#90506.3] DCT+14
^BQI(90506.4 - [#90506.4] TBS+5, TBS+6, TBS+7, TBS+8, TBS+9
^BQI(90507 - [#90507] REG+5
^BQI(90509.1 - [#90509.1] CMT+5, CMT+6, CMT+7
^DD("DD" ERR+3
^DD(2 SEX+4
^DD(90509 TSTA+4
^TMP("BQITABLE" TAB+10
^USR(8930 - [#8930] CLS+5
^USR(8930.3 - [#8930.3] CLS+2, CLS+4
^XTMP("BQICOMM" COMM+5, COMM+7, COMM+8, COMM+9

Label References

Name Line Occurrences
BEN TAB+97
CMT TAB+55
COMM TAB+33, TAB+34
COMMTX TAB+93
DCT TAB+75
REG TAB+49
REM TAB+101
SEX TAB+69
TBL TAB+38, TAB+51, TAB+53, TAB+61, TAB+65, TAB+66, TAB+71
TBS TAB+95
TSTA TAB+57
VW TAB+73

Naked Globals

Name Field # of Occurrence
^(0 TBS+9

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
BENIEN BEN+1~, BEN+2*, BEN+4*, BEN+5, BEN+6, BEN+7
BJ TSTA+1~, TSTA+5*, TSTA+6, TSTA+8, SEX+1~, SEX+5*, SEX+6
>> BMXSEC TBL+16*, ERR+4*
BQILOC VW+1~, VW+2, VW+3, VW+4, VW+6
CIEN COMM+1~, COMM+6*, COMM+7*, COMM+8, COMM+9
CODE TSTA+1~, TSTA+6*, TSTA+7, TSTA+8, SEX+1~, SEX+6*, SEX+7, SEX+8, BEN+1~, REM+1~
, REM+6*, REM+7, REM+8, REM+9, REM+10, REM+11, REM+12, REM+13
COM COMMTX+1~, COMMTX+8*, COMMTX+9
COMTXNM COMMTX+1~, COMMTX+10*, COMMTX+11, COMMTX+12
DATA TBL~, TBL+21, TBL+35, DONE, TAB~, TAB+10*, TAB+11, TAB+17, TAB+19, TAB+21
, TAB+22, TAB+23, TAB+25, TAB+26, TAB+27, TAB+29, TAB+30, TAB+31, TAB+33, TAB+34
, TAB+36, TAB+38, TAB+40, TAB+41, TAB+43, TAB+45, TAB+47, TAB+49, TAB+51, TAB+53
, TAB+55, TAB+57, TAB+59, TAB+61, TAB+62, TAB+63, TAB+65, TAB+66, TAB+67, TAB+68
, TAB+69, TAB+71, TAB+73, TAB+75, TAB+77, TAB+79, TAB+81, TAB+82, TAB+84, TAB+85
, TAB+87, TAB+88, TAB+90, TAB+91, TAB+93, TAB+95, TAB+97, TAB+99, TAB+101, TAB+103
, TAB+105, TAB+107, TAB+109, TAB+111, TAB+113, TAB+115, TAB+117, TAB+119, TAB+121, TAB+123
, TAB+124, TAB+125, TAB+126, TAB+128, TAB+129, TAB+130, TAB+132, CMT~, CMT+3, CMT+8
, CMT+9, TSTA~, TSTA+3, TSTA+8, TSTA+9, SEX~, SEX+3, SEX+8, SEX+9, TBS~
, TBS+3, TBS+9, TBS+10, VW~, VW+4, VW+5, DCT~, DCT+2, DCT+15, DCT+16
, REG~, REG+3, REG+13, REG+14, COMM~, COMM+3, COMM+9, COMM+10, COMMTX~, COMMTX+3
, COMMTX+11, COMMTX+13, BEN~, BEN+3, BEN+7, BEN+8, REM~, REM+3, REM+13, REM+14
, ERR+5
DLEN TBL+9~, TBL+20*, TBL+21
DT TAB+12
ERRDTM ERR+2~, ERR+3*, ERR+4
FILE TBL~, TBL+16, TBL+18, TBL+19, TBL+28, TBL+29, COMM~
FLAG CMT+1~, CMT+7*, CMT+8, TSTA+1~, SEX+1~, COMM~, COMM+8
GLBREF TBL+9~, TBL+18*, TBL+25, TBL+26, TBL+27
IACT DCT+3~, DCT+8*, DCT+15
IEN TBL+9~, TBL+24*, TBL+25*, TBL+26, TBL+27, TBL+28, TBL+35, CMT+4*, CMT+5*, CMT+6
, CMT+7, CMT+8, TBS+1~, TBS+6*, TBS+7, TBS+8, TBS+9, DCT+3~, DCT+4*, DCT+5*
, DCT+6, DCT+8, DCT+9, DCT+11, DCT+15, REG+1~, REG+4*, REG+5*, REG+7, REG+8
, REG+9, REG+10, REG+11, REG+13
II TBL+12*, TBL+21, TBL+35*, DONE*, TAB+8~, TAB+14*, CMT+2*, CMT+3, CMT+8*, CMT+9*
, TSTA+2*, TSTA+3, TSTA+8*, TSTA+9*, SEX+2*, SEX+3, SEX+8*, SEX+9*, TBS+2*, TBS+3
, TBS+9*, TBS+10*, VW+4*, VW+5*, DCT+1*, DCT+2, DCT+7*, DCT+15, DCT+16*, REG+1~
, REG+2*, REG+3, REG+13*, REG+14*, COMM+2*, COMM+3, COMM+9*, COMM+10*, COMMTX+3, COMMTX+11*
, COMMTX+13*, BEN+3, BEN+7*, BEN+8*, REM+3, REM+13*, REM+14*, ERR+5*
INAC TBL~, TBL+10*, TBL+23, TBL+27
ITEM COMMTX+1~, COMMTX+6*, COMMTX+7*, COMMTX+8
LENGTH TBL+9~, TBL+19*, TBL+20
LII VW+1~, VW+3*, VW+4
NAME DCT+9*, DCT+15, REG+1~, REG+8*, REG+13, BEN+1~, BEN+6*, BEN+7, REM+1~, REM+6*
, REM+8*, REM+9*, REM+10*, REM+11*, REM+12*, REM+13
NODE TBL+9~, TBL+23*, TBL+27
OK COMMTX+1~, COMMTX+6*, COMMTX+7, COMMTX+10*
ORD TBS+1~, TBS+4*, TBS+5*, TBS+6
PEC TBL+9~, TBL+23*, TBL+27
PR CLS~, CLS+2
REG DCT+3~, DCT+11*, DCT+12, DCT+13
REGFL DCT+3~, DCT+13*, DCT+14
REGIEN DCT+3~, DCT+7*, DCT+14*, DCT+15
RLTD REG+1~, REG+10*, REG+13
RM REM+1~, REM+2*, REM+4*, REM+5, REM+6
SEL TBS+1~, TBS+8*, TBS+9
SREG REG+1~, REG+9*, REG+13
STAT REG+1~, REG+11*, REG+12*, REG+13
TAXIEN COMMTX+1~, COMMTX+2*, COMMTX+4*, COMMTX+5, COMMTX+7, COMMTX+8, COMMTX+10, COMMTX+11
TEST1 TBL+9~
TEXT TAB~, TAB+17, TAB+19, TAB+21, TAB+22, TAB+23, TAB+25, TAB+26, TAB+27, TAB+29
, TAB+30, TAB+31, TAB+33, TAB+34, TAB+36, TAB+38, TAB+40, TAB+41, TAB+43, TAB+45
, TAB+47, TAB+49, TAB+51, TAB+53, TAB+55, TAB+57, TAB+59, TAB+61, TAB+62, TAB+63
, TAB+65, TAB+66, TAB+67, TAB+68, TAB+69, TAB+71, TAB+73, TAB+75, TAB+77, TAB+79
, TAB+81, TAB+82, TAB+84, TAB+85, TAB+87, TAB+88, TAB+90, TAB+91, TAB+93, TAB+95
, TAB+97, TAB+99, TAB+101, TAB+103, TAB+105, TAB+107, TAB+109, TAB+111, TAB+113, TAB+115
, TAB+117, TAB+119, TAB+121, TAB+123, TAB+124, TAB+125, TAB+126, TAB+128, TAB+129, TAB+130
, TAB+132, TAB+134!, TSTA+1~, TSTA+7*, TSTA+8, SEX+1~, SEX+7*, SEX+8
TXT TBL+9~, TBL+28*, TBL+30*, TBL+31, TBL+32*, TBL+33, TBL+34*, TBL+35
TYPE CLS+1*, CLS+4*, CLS+5*, CLS+6, COMMTX+1~, COMMTX+5*
U TAB+12, CLS+4, CLS+5, CMT+6, CMT+7, TSTA+4, SEX+4, TBS+7, TBS+8, TBS+9
, COMM+8, COMMTX+8
UID TAB+8~, TAB+9*, TAB+10
>> USN CLS+1*, CLS+2*, CLS+3, CLS+4
VALUE TSTA+1~, TSTA+4*, TSTA+5, TSTA+6, SEX+1~, SEX+4*, SEX+5, SEX+6
X TBL+9~, TAB+8~
Y ERR+2~, ERR+3*
>> ZTSK TAB+9
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Used in RPC |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  All